Active Ingredient (In Each Tablet)

Fexofenadine HCl 180 mg

Purpose

Antihistamine

Uses

reduces hives and relieves itching due to hives (urticaria). This product will not prevent hives or an allergic skin reaction from occurring.

Warnings

Severe Allery Warning: Get emergency help immediately if you have hives along with any of the following symptoms:

  • trouble swallowing
  • dizziness or loss of consciousness
  • swelling of tongue
  • swelling in or around mouth
  • trouble speaking
  • wheezing or problems breathing
  • drooling
  • These symptoms may be signs of anaphylactic shock. This condition can be life threatening if not treated by a health professional immediately. Symptoms of anaphylactic shock may occur when hives first appear or up to a few hours later.

    Not a Substitute for Epinephrine. If your doctor has prescribed an epinephrine injector for “anaphylaxis” or severe allergy symptoms that could occur with your hives, never use this product as a substitute for the epinephrine injector. If you have been prescribed an epinephrine injector, you should carry it with you at all times.

Do Not Use

  • to prevent hives from any known cause such as:
    • foods
    • insect stings
    • medicines
    • latex or rubber gloves
    •  because this product will not stop hives from occurring. Avoiding the cause of your hives is the only way to prevent them. Hives can sometimes be serious. If you do not know the cause of your hives, see your doctor for a medical exam. Your doctor may be able to help you find a cause.
    • if you have ever had an allergic reaction to this product or any of its ingredients

Ask A Doctor Before Use If You Have

  • kidney disease. Your doctor should determine if you need a different dose.
  • hives that are an unusual color, look bruised or blistered
  • hives that do not itch

When Using This Product

  • do not take more than directed
  • do not take at the same time as aluminum or magnesium antacids
  • do not take with fruit juices (see Directions)

Stop Use And Ask A Doctor If

  • an allergic reaction to this product occurs. Seek medical help right away.
  • symptoms do not improve after 3 days of treatment
  • the hives have lasted more than 6 weeks

If Pregnant Or Breast-Feeding,

ask a health professional before use.

Keep Out Of Reach Of Children.

In case of overdose,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away (1-800-222-1222).

Directions

adults and children 12 years of age and over

take one 180 mg tablet with water once a day; do not take more than 1 tablet in 24 hours

children under 12 years of age

do not use

adults 65 years of age and older

ask a doctor

consumers with kidney disease

ask a doctor

Other Information

  • do not use if printed foil under cap is broken or missing
  • store between 20°-25°C (68°-77°F)
  • protect from excessive moisture
  • this product meets the requirements of USP Dissolution Test 2

Inactive Ingredients

colloidal silicon dioxide, croscarmellose sodium, FD&C blue #2 aluminum lake, FD&C red #40 aluminum lake, FD&C yellow #6 aluminum lake, lactose monohydrate, magnesium stearate, microcrystalline cellulose, polyethylene glycol, polyvinyl alcohol, pregelatinized starch, talc, titanium dioxide
